Weather Radio coverage map for upstate New York.[/caption]When Vice President Joe Biden visited Gov. Andrew Cuomo in Albany Jan. 7, they unveiled “Reimagining New York for a New Reality,” a $17 billion strategy that, among other post-Hurricane Sandy storm-related projects, includes an upgrade to New York's weather warning system. The plan calls for, "building the most advanced weather detection system in the nation, with 125 interconnected weather stations to provide real-time warnings of local extreme weather and flood conditions." On Fri., Feb. 7, Cuomo unveiled $23.6 million in spending on updating the states weather detection equipment, and upping weather stations around the state from 27 to 125, with 17 higher-grade "profiling" stations.
